Subject: [PATCH] mm/hugetlb: move hugetlb_sysctl_init() to the __init section

From: Marc Herbert <Marc.Herbert@...ux.intel.com>

hugetlb_sysctl_init() is only invoked once by an __init function and is
merely a wrapper around another __init function so there is not reason
to keep it.

Fixes the following warning when toning down some GCC inline options:

 WARNING: modpost: vmlinux: section mismatch in reference:
   hugetlb_sysctl_init+0x1b (section: .text) ->
     __register_sysctl_init (section: .init.text)
